Objectives
Objective
s

The main interest of this project is attributed to


the search for a solution to simplify the
automation of public lighting control with a
programmable system at a reduced price, to try to
avoid any waste of electricity (energy saver).
For this, the project aims to turn on the external
power poles without the intervention of man.
Infrared barrier is used specifically in low traffic
areas and do not require that the lighting is
operational all night.

Temperature sensor LM35


The temperature sensor is a device that
converts a physical quantity (temperature) in
an electric quantity (voltage or current).

What is microcontroller
is a small computer on a
single integrated circuit containing
a processor core, memory, and
programmable input/output peripherals.

PIC Microcontroller
The name PIC, (Peripheral Interface
Controller), refers to a group of
Microcontrollers, produced by Microchip.
As its name suggests, a microcontroller is
a tiny device used to control other
electronic devices.
12

PIC microcontroller(Contd.)
A microcontroller is a digital integrated
circuit, and consists of:
Central Processing Unit
Memory
Input ports
Output ports
